Output fa60f66579d2e6c4f33ab90e5348104e7353902c8bf758db562eace5af976f35:31

value
18505614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 433a01932c721842598939bc175693661bc2e8dd OP_EQUAL
address
ME2czcy2WxoBiNt5G56bi19MCSAvb2EHtU
transaction
fa60f66579d2e6c4f33ab90e5348104e7353902c8bf758db562eace5af976f35
spent
true